Divus Augustus, (after AD 14), Orichalcum sestertius, (28.69 g). Rome Mint, under Tiberius, issued A.D. 35-36, obv. OB CIVES SER inscribed on shield surrounded by oak wreath, DIVO AVGVSTO S P Q R around, two adduced Capricorns and globe below, rev. TI. CAESAR DIVI AVG F AVGVST P M TR POT XXXVIII around large S C, (S.1763, RIC [Tiberius] 63, BMC 109, C. [Augustus] 303). Dark brown patina with minor reverse roughness, otherwise good very fine and rare.

Ex New York International Coin Convention, December 9, 1994.
